The Prime Minister of Ukraine Denys Shmyhal discussed Ukraine’s integration into the EU and NATO with members of the Saeima led by Speaker Daiga Mieriņa. The meeting took place on 4 April as part of the government team’s visit to Latvia.
Denys Shmyhal thanked Latvia for its support in Ukraine’s integration and stressed that it was very important for Ukraine to start negotiations on joining the EU by the end of June this year.
The parties also discussed the establishment of joint ventures.
“We highly appreciate Latvia’s initiative to launch grant programmes for joint ventures. This will bring our cooperation to a new level,” the Head of Ukrainian Government said.
The participants of the meeting paid special attention to russia’s continuous shelling of Ukrainian territories, in particular the recent attacks on Kharkiv.
“We need to stand together against russian terrorism and we are grateful to Latvia for its reliable support in this matter,” said Denys Shmyhal.
The Prime Minister of Ukraine and representatives of the Latvian Saeima also discussed the importance of the ban on imports of agricultural products from russia to the EU.
